B.3.2 Current Program Status Register (CPSR) . ARM is a RISC4 CPU designed with constant opcode length in mind, which had some The very first stack element, just like in the previous case, is the RA. 9 Register och primärminne Högnivåspråk: a=b+c+d; Alternativ 1: ADD a, b, c //​adderar b flaggorna är: N: 1 om resultatet är negativt (annars 0) Z: 1 om resultatet är noll (annars 0) V: 1 RISC (Reduced Instruction Set Computers): förenkla  The MSP430F563x features a powerful 16-bit RISC CPU, 16-bit registers, and MCU på instegsnivå i RA-familjen baserad på en Arm® Cortex-M23-kärna med  il loro talento, confermando il grande successo riscosso durante le passate edizioni. Ansökan till våra fristående kurser med start ht 2021 är öppen, When you fill out the registration, it is important that you make sure to press the In case of questions about Double V. g and contact Lisa Nyberg lisa.nyberg@​lund.se,  av MBG Björkqvist · 2017 — Register Transfer Level teknik och en RISC-processor för databehandling. Quartus II (v.11.0) är ett verktyg för konstruktion av programmerbara logiska  register.

Here GCC knows about the Risc-V Linux ABI where register usage is defined as: x1, ra, return address for jumps, no. Oct 2, 2019 Y86 Rudiments. RISC vs. CISC architectures. CS429 Slideset 6: 2 2 fn rA rB.

In RISC-V, we have two special CS (control and status) registers that control this CPU communication. Each CSR is assigned a DWARF register number corresponding to its CSR number given in Volume II: Privileged Architecture of The RISC-V Instruction Set Manual plus 4096. Linux-specific ABI This section of the RISC-V ELF psABI specification only applies to Linux-based systems.

Log in or register to post comments. Log in or There's a local electronic parts and supply store called Ra-Elco Plated through hole vs. RISC-V ISA är en direkt utveckling från en serie akademiska datordesignprojekt.

These arguments all begin with -m, and are all specific to the RISC-V architecture port. In general, we've tried to match existing conventions for these arguments, but like pretty much everything else there are enough quirks to warrant a blog post it is the preset return register for RISC V lw ra 12 sp addi sp sp 16 dealocate from ECE 395 at New Jersey Institute Of Technology 2017-08-28 · Last week's blog entry discussed relocations and how they apply to the RISC-V toolchain. This week we'll be delving a bit deeper into the RISC-V linker to discuss linker relaxation, a concept so important it has greatly shaped the design of the RISC-V ISA. Linker relaxation is a mechanism for optimizing programs at link-time, as opposed to traditional program optimization which happens at Se hela listan på khann.tistory.com Se hela listan på blog.csdn.net A RISC-V hardware platform can contain one or more RISC-V-compatible processing cores to- gether with other non-RISC-V-compatible cores, xed-function accelerators, various physical mem- ory structures, I/O devices, and an interconnect structure to allow the components to communicate.
In this tutorial we'll be using RARS a Risc-V simulator with macro and include This function also allows an alternative return register (normally RA) - it also  The exames are a little bit exhausting, but effectively measure what was learned. Helpful? RA. Apr 7, 2018. What register is used as the stack pointer? What is a ebreak instruction in the sample program? How would you define a constant named 'BLUE' and assign  Feb 9, 2018 As [Robert Baruch] sets out to demonstrate, the combination of RISC of RISC-V before explaining the mechanics of a register for his RISC-V  Jun 26, 2020 SiFive has also released the RTL (register-transfer level) code for Freedom E310 under an open source license that will allow chip designers to  RA Cores - Selling Fun Since 1992. of Jessie Russell comparing our 32" EPP vs Depron Yak55 kits: A gallery of some of our Customer's Flat Foamie builds  Oct 2, 2019 Y86 Rudiments.

Numeric ABI name Meaning. Saver x0 zero. Hard-wired zero n/a x1 ra. Return address. Caller x2 sp. Stack pointer. Callee x3 gp.
В этой статье мы исследуем различные низкоуровневые концепции (компиляция и компоновка, примитивные среды выполнения, ассемблер и многое другое) через призму архитектуры risc-v и её экосистемы. http://llvm.org/devmtg/2018-10/—LLVM backend development by example (RISC-V) - Alex BradburySlides: —This tutorial steps through how to develop an LLVM back RISC cũng chiếm lĩnh thị trường workstation trong hầu hết những năm 90. Sau khi Sun cho ra đời SPARCstation, các hãng khác cũng vội vã hoàn thành các hệ thống dựa trên RISC của mình. Thậm chí ngày nay thế giới của các mainframe cũng hoàn toàn dựa trên RISC.

RISC”. Men. Local Link- nala register och en trestegs pipe- line. P a en RISC-processor (som MIPS) anser man att dessa instruktioner ar f or Dessa registers v arden f orst ors av avbrottshantera- V ardet i ra ska sparas.
RISC-V Procedure convention. 1. Prepare parameters in  Jan 26, 2018 The RISC-V project de/ines and describes a standardized Instruction Set. Architecture (ISA). Register x1 - The Return Address (“ra”). 150. RISC-V base unprivileged integer register state.